The Movement for the Survival of the Izon Ethnic Nationality in the Niger Delta (MOSIEND) has congratulated Mrs. Didi Walson-Jack on her appointment as Head of Civil Service of the Federation.
The President of MOSIEND, Dr Kennedy Tonjo-West, in a statement, expressed gratitude to President Tinubu for finding Walson-Jack, an illustrious daughter of Ijaw nation worthy of the appointment.
He described Walson-Jack’s appointment as a square peg in a square hole, assuring the president that she would bring her wealth of experience to bear and also bring about reforms that will better the lots of the federal government and workers.
Tonjo-West said, “Didi is an asset to the federal government, and we know that president Tinubu will enjoy her wealth of experience because of her proven track records of integrity.
“The president will always enjoy her invaluable contributions to the growth and betterment of the civil service, as well as support to government in implementing or accomplishing its policies especially as it relates to the workforce.
“Didi is somebody who is passionate about one Nigeria and she’s not tribalistic at all, and we know she will not disappoint.
“We want all Niger Delta people to throw their weight behind her to succeed; so that she can be able to galvanize government to achieve the Renewed Hope agenda for the betterment of all,” he added.
